The student obtains 0.15 g of triphenylmethanol. What is the percent yield for this reaction? Br = 80g/mol; C = 12 g/mol, O = 16g/mol. Percent yield = (actual yield/theoretical yield) × 100
Actual yield obtained = 0.15g of triphenyl methanol
Initial amount of triphenyl bromomethane used =0.30g
Molar mass of triphenyl bromomethane (C19H15Br) = 12×19+15×1+80 =323.2g/mol
Molar mass of triphenyl methanol (C19H16O) = 12×19+1×16+16 = 260.3g/mol
So, 323.2g of triphenyl bromomethane produce 260.3g of triphenyl methanol
So,0.30g of triphenyl bromomethane will produce (260.3/323.2)×0.30g of triphenylmethanol
Thus theoretical yield of triphenylmethanol =0.242g
Thus,percent yield = (0.15/0.242) × 100 = 61.98%
